Understanding the MB-920 Exam Overview
The MB-920 exam is titled “Microsoft Dynamics 365 Fundamentals” with a focus on Finance and Operations. It serves as a foundational certification that validates your knowledge of core business processes handled within Dynamics 365 Finance and Operations modules.
Key details include:
- Price: Varies by region, typically around $99 USD
- Delivery Methods: Online proctored exams and testing centers
- Regional Variations: Exam availability and language options depend on location
The exam features approximately 40-60 questions with a duration of 120 minutes. Questions are designed to assess both conceptual understanding and practical application, with a scoring system that requires a passing score of around 700 out of 1000.
The format includes multiple-choice questions, scenario-based items, and drag-and-drop exercises. Understanding this structure helps you allocate time effectively and familiarize yourself with question types. The exam closely mirrors real-world business processes, emphasizing the application of concepts in scenarios like financial reporting, inventory management, and project oversight.

Core Finance and Operations Concepts (20–25%)
This domain tests your knowledge of financial management principles within Dynamics 365, including how businesses manage their finances through modules like general ledger, accounts payable, receivable, and fixed assets.
Key topics include:
- Understanding the structure of the general ledger and chart of accounts
- Managing accounts payable and receivable processes
- Handling fixed assets, depreciation, and asset lifecycle
- Financial reporting, such as balance sheets and income statements
- Compliance features like audit trails and security controls
For example, knowing how to configure a ledger to track multiple currencies or how to generate financial statements helps in practical scenarios. Microsoft provides extensive documentation and tutorials on these topics, which are essential for mastery.

Core Supply Chain Management Concepts (20–25%)
This domain centers on how Dynamics 365 manages inventory, procurement, and logistics—key for organizations aiming to optimize their supply chain operations. Your understanding of demand forecasting, warehouse management, and order processing is critical.
Important topics include:
- Configuring inventory modules for different product types and locations
- Managing procurement cycles and vendor relationships
- Implementing warehouse management strategies, including barcode scanning and bin setup
- Order processing workflows and delivery scheduling
- Monitoring supply chain KPIs like inventory turnover and order accuracy
Case studies often involve scenarios such as reducing stockouts or improving delivery times through system automation. Practical exercises, such as creating purchase orders or setting up warehouse locations, reinforce learning.

Core Retail Concepts (20–25%)
Retail management within Dynamics 365 involves engaging customers, managing sales channels, and optimizing inventory for retail businesses. This domain covers features that support omnichannel strategies, including POS systems and customer engagement tools.
Topics include:
- Configuring and managing POS systems for retail outlets
- Implementing retail-specific inventory management
- Handling pricing strategies, discounts, and promotions
- Enhancing customer experience via personalized marketing and loyalty programs
- Integrating online and offline sales channels for seamless retailing
Real-world examples include deploying Dynamics 365 Commerce to unify e-commerce and physical store operations, resulting in improved customer satisfaction and increased sales.

Core Project Management Concepts (20–25%)
This area emphasizes managing projects, resources, and budgets using Dynamics 365. Understanding project accounting, resource allocation, and tracking progress is vital.
Key concepts include:
- Creating and managing project budgets and forecasts
- Allocating resources and tracking utilization
- Recording project expenses and revenues
- Integrating project management with finance modules for accurate billing
- Utilizing dashboards and reports for project oversight
Case studies often involve scenarios like delivering projects on time and within budget, or analyzing project profitability. Tools such as Project Service Automation provide insights into resource performance and project health.

Core Human Resources Concepts (10–15%)
This domain covers HR management features, including employee records, payroll processing, talent acquisition, and compliance reporting. It’s essential for understanding how Dynamics 365 supports organizational HR functions.
Topics include:
- Managing employee profiles, roles, and organizational hierarchies
- Automating payroll and benefits administration
- Tracking performance appraisals and talent development
- Ensuring compliance with labor laws and reporting requirements
- Leveraging HR data for strategic decision-making
Practical tips involve navigating HR dashboards, generating compliance reports, and understanding the integration points with other modules like payroll and talent management.

Practical Tips for Taking the Exam
Choosing between in-person and online exams depends on your comfort level and available facilities. Remote proctoring offers flexibility but requires a quiet, interruption-free environment and proper setup.
Strategies include:
- Reading questions carefully and managing your time—aim for roughly 2 minutes per question
- Answering easier questions first to secure points and returning to difficult ones later
- Using elimination techniques for multiple-choice questions
- Analyzing case studies by breaking down scenarios into key components and applying your knowledge systematically
During the exam, monitor the clock and avoid spending too much time on single questions. Practice helps build confidence and reduces exam anxiety.
